The Governance Token is Bones (include voting rights like on a board for a major corp.) Leash is the prize High dollar for investment token... Shiba Swap is a coin or token swap platform where for the gas fees of ethereum you can pay to convert your coins to any other ERC coin which is currently on the ERC20 or Etherum network... (Think like AT&T) Bitcoin is on BTC or something Network think Sprint) Much slower network and not great coverage slow Then Shibarium which promised blistering speeds for transactions and also the low cost...of a .05-.50 per transaction That sure would be great about now...
